Background

NEET PG 2024 Supreme Court Hearing Live Updates: The Supreme Court will resume the hearing on the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ET) PG 2024 today, October 25. In the plea, Aspirants raised concerns regarding last-minute changes to the exam pattern and a lack of transparency in the results process. The hearing, initially scheduled for October 4, was postponed due to the absence of Chief Justice DY Chandrachud, who was to preside over the case. In a prior September hearing, a bench comprising Chief Justice DY Chandrachud, Justice JB Pardiwala and Justice Manoj Misra called the decision to alter the exam pattern just three days before the exam "unusual." The court had then issued notices to the National Board of Examinations in Medical Sciences (NBEMS) and the Centre, asking them to respond within a week, after considering the petitioners' arguments.

Lakhs of candidates are anxiously awaiting the release of the NEET PG counselling schedule, which has been delayed. Even doctors have urged the Health Minister to instruct the Medical Counselling Committee (MCC) to expedite the release of the schedule and speed up the admission process. With the Supreme Court set to hear the NEET PG plea today, candidates are hopeful the counselling schedule will be announced this week.

The MCC will conduct counselling for AIQ Round 1, AIQ Round 2, AIQ Mop-up Round, and AIQ Stray Vacancy Round. The delay has impacted over 10 lakh candidates, causing uncertainty and potentially leading to further delays in the academic session.

NEET PG 2024 Counselling Eligibility & More

Only candidates who qualify for NEET PG by meeting the minimum cut-off percentile are eligible to participate in the seat allotment process. The NEET PG counselling process includes online registration, fee payment, choice declaration, seat allotment results, and reporting.

To participate in counselling, candidates must register online and declare their choices. Registration can be completed on the official MCC website at mcc.nic.in. During registration, candidates need to log in using their email ID and mobile number, then fill out the application form.

Candidates can declare multiple choices based on their preferred colleges and courses. It is important to save and lock these choices before the deadline, as there will be no option to change them afterward. Choices will be automatically locked after the final date.

Documents Required For NEET PG Counselling 2024

The following documents are required for NEET PG 2024 admission:

  • NEET PG Admit Card
  • Provisional/Permanent Registration Certificate
  • NEET PG Result
  • NEET PG Rank Card
  • Internship Completion Certificate
  • MBBS Degree Certificate
  • Disability Certificate (if applicable)
  • ID Proof (Aadhaar Card, PAN Card, Voter ID, or Passport)
  • Caste Certificate (if applicable)
  • Three Passport Size Photographs
  • Character Certificate (if applicable)
  • Proof of payment of counselling fee
  • MCC-issued Allotment Letter
  • Transfer Certificate from the last attended college (if applicable)
  • Migration Certificate from the Board/University (if applicable)
  • Signed Affidavit by the student and their parent/guardian
  • Bonafide Certificate (if applicable)
  • Gap Certificate (if applicable)
  • Bond/Agreement, if required by the respective state/college

NEET PG 2024 Counselling Registration Fee

Aspirants must pay a registration fee to successfully submit their NEET PG 2024 counselling forms. Here are the details of the registration fees for NEET PG counselling 2024:

Deemed University Candidates: INR 5,000

ST/SC/PwD/OBC Candidates: INR 500

AIQ or Central University General Category Candidates: INR 1,000
